Affected Projects

hdf5 v1.14.6 (https://github.com/HDFGroup/hdf5)

Problem Type

CWE-122: Heap-based Buffer Overflow

Description

Summary

A heap-buffer-overflow vulnerability was discovered in the H5SM_delete function within the HDF5 Library. This issue occurs when processing certain .h5 files, leading to an out-of-bounds read and potential application crash.

Details

The vulnerability arises in the H5SM_delete function defined in H5SM.c at line 1542. The function fails to properly check the buffer boundaries, resulting in a read operation beyond the allocated memory.

PoC

Steps to reproduce:

  1. Clone the hdf5 repository and build it using the following commands :
export CC='clang'
export CFLAGS='-fsanitize=address,fuzzer-no-link -O1 -g'
export CXX='clang++'
export CXXFLAGS='-fsanitize=address,fuzzer -O1 -g'

export LDFLAGS="${CFLAGS}"
export CMAKE_C_FLAGS="${CC} ${CFLAGS}"
export CMAKE_CXX_FLAGS="${CXX} ${CXXFLAGS}"

mkdir build-dir
cd build-dir
cmake -G "Unix Makefiles" \
    -DCMAKE_BUILD_TYPE:STRING=Release \
    -DBUILD_SHARED_LIBS:BOOL=OFF \
    -DBUILD_TESTING:BOOL=OFF \
    -DCMAKE_VERBOSE_MAKEFILES:BOOL=ON \
    -DHDF5_BUILD_EXAMPLES:BOOL=OFF \
    -DHDF5_BUILD_TOOLS:BOOL=OFF \
    -DHDF5_ENABLE_SANITIZERS:BOOL=ON \
    -DHDF5_ENABLE_Z_LIB_SUPPORT:BOOL=ON \
    ..

cmake --build . --verbose --config Release -j$(nproc)
  1. Compile the fuzzer:
$CC $CFLAGS  -std=c99 -c \
  -I$SRC/hdf5/src -I$SRC/hdf5/build-dir/src -I./src/H5FDsubfiling/ \
  $SRC/h5_extended_fuzzer.c
$CXX $CXXFLAGS h5_extended_fuzzer.o ./build-dir/bin/libhdf5.a -lz -o $OUT/h5_extended_fuzzer
  1. Run the fuzzer to trigger the segmentation fault:

h5_extended_crash.zip

./h5_extended_fuzzer h5_extended_crash.h5

The invalid read access will cause AddressSanitizer to report a segmentation fault during the execution of the post-processing logic.
